Saint-Sulpice-sur-Risle is a locality situated in the Basse-Normandie region of France. For road and gravel cyclists, Saint-Sulpice-sur-Risle offers a tranquil and peaceful setting with quiet roads winding through the countryside. While it may not boast any famous cycling spots or challenging climbs, the locality provides an opportunity to immerse oneself in the charm and beauty of rural France. Cyclists can enjoy leisurely rides, explore quaint villages, and take in the scenic views. Saint-Sulpice-sur-Risle is a hidden gem for those seeking peaceful cycling routes away from busy tourist areas.

Experience the countryside charm as you cycle to the delightful village of Saint-Hilaire-sur-Risle.
Immerse yourself in the rustic beauty of the Normandy countryside as you cycle towards the delightful village of Saint-Hilaire-sur-Risle. With a challenging ascent of 627 meters and a distance of 77 kilometers, this road cycling route is recommended for experienced cyclists who enjoy a demanding challenge. Along the way, explore Les Authieux-du-Puits, a charming village with traditional Norman houses and beautiful gardens. Discover the historic town of Gacé, known for its charming streets and architectural treasures. This scenic route offers a mix of rolling hills, picturesque landscapes, and cultural heritage.
Embark on a gravel adventure to the historical Tour Chappe du Buat.
Explore the rugged beauty of Basse-Normandie on this gravel cycling route that leads you to the historical Tour Chappe du Buat. With an ascent of 322 meters and a distance of 50 kilometers, this route is suitable for intermediate level cyclists who are comfortable with off-road biking. Admire the stunning landscapes as you make your way through picturesque villages like Randonnai and Bresolettes. Discover hidden treasures like Les Aspres, with its charming rural setting and fascinating history. This gravel adventure promises exhilarating cycling and breathtaking views of the Normandy countryside.
